Abstract

The main aim of this paper is to decrease the mortality rate caused due to fire accidents that occur in locomotives. This is the impetus behind the design of our proposal. The main objective of this proposal is to rescue lives from such fire accidents at the earliest as possible, especially designed for moving locomotives. The over all proposed system has been segmented into four main parts: i) Fire Suppressing (Extinguishing) System ii) Actuating Mechanism iii) Alarming System iv) Telemetry System. The compartments are fitted with temperature sensor-LM35, smoke detector-21007581,microprocessor-MSP430FR5729 (Launch Pad),circuit breaker- TPS2311, solenoid vale, GSMmodule-SIM900,anda buzzer. The temperature sensor fitted in every compartment detects a temperature (>70oc), and these signals are sent to the microprocessor. Once the signals are received, the developed rescue system starts its action. The first action plan of the developed system is to pull the chain and stop the moving locomotive. Further the compartment is isolated from electrical supply by activating the circuit breaker. A moving train can be the main cause for the advancement of fire to the next compartments, and thereby increasing the death toll. Thus, a need arises to bring the fire under control. This is taken care by the above discussed developed chain actuating mechanism and the circuit breaker in this paper. Fire extinguishing system consists of a solenoid valve. Water from the cubicle tank is directed into the compartment via the solenoid valve to suppress the fire. GSM module is used for transmission of data to the official at a near by station house. The buzzer (alarm) performs the task of alerting the people.
